Bio

Chelsea Johnson joined the Colby cross country/track & field coaching staff in August 2021.

As a student-athlete at Fort Hays State University in Hays, Kan., Johnson was a two-year captain on the Tiger cross country and track teams. She was a key member of the 2016 Tiger women’s cross country squad that posted the highest finish in program history on her way to NCAA Division II all-region cross country honors. Johnson also earned All-Mid-America Intercollegiate Athletics Association (MIAA) recognition in the 10,000 meters for her 2018 finish in the conference.

On top of athletic accolades, she has several academic and leadership awards. In 2016, she earned NCAA Academic All-American distinction in cross country. She was also an MIAA Scholar Athlete and won the FHSU Cross Country Leadership Award in 2018.

After completing her eligibility, Johnson transitioned into a graduate assistant role for FHSU during the 2018-2019 year. She holds a bachelor’s degree in health and human performance and a master’s degree in exercise science.

In addition to working with the Trojan distance runners, Johnson works full-time as a coach for a digital health company that provides consumers with personalized information, programs, and resources to improve their health. She is also an ACE (American Council on Exercise) certified health coach.
